Lithium-6 is valued as a source material for tritium production and as a neutron absorber in nuclear fusion. Natural lithium contains about 7.5% lithium-6 from which large amounts of lithium-6 have been produced by isotope separation for use in nuclear weapons. Web2 nov. 2024 · If we assume each 18650 cell weighs about 45 g then the gravimetric energy density is ~ 270 Wh/kg. The performance limit of this chemistry with the industry standard cathode thickness was recently estimated to be 1200 Wh/L (400 Wh/kg). “Note that if zero inactive components are used, the fundamental chemistry limit is ~ 470 Wh/kg. WebDensity of lithium hydroxide, LiOH(aq) Table 1. Estimated values of absolute density (g/cm 3) of aqueous lithium hydroxide solutions {LiOH + H 2 O) as function of electrolyte molality m and temperature T (at pressure p = 1 bar). Values in the table are consistent with the density of pure water calculated with the IAPWS-95 equation of state.
